This video is for those of you who may be using Inkscape with a lower resolution screen.You may notice that the toolbar on the lower left-hand side of your menu is being cut off, and because of that you can't access all of your tools. To fix this problem, all you have to do is pull the menu out by clicking and dragging it and the tools are then placed into multiple vertical columns, allowing you to access them.
If you're not able to pull your menu out like this then be sure to upgrade to the latest version of Inkscape here: inkscape.org/release/
Additionally, you may notice that some of your system tools are missing from the toolbar at the top of your screen. This is because of a layout change in the latest version of Inkscape that now places those tools on the right-hand side of your screen by default.
To revert back to the classic mode, all you have to do is disable Wide Screen mode by going to View and deselecting Wide Screen, and then your system tools should accessible.
